What does a landowner in agriculture specializing in poultry farming do? – Tasks and work environment
A landowner in agriculture focusing on poultry breeding is responsible for the operation and management of farms where the main focus is on raising poultry, such as chickens, hens, or turkeys. Tasks include planning production, purchasing feed and materials, overseeing animal health, and monitoring care routines. The role also involves personnel management, financial administration, and contact with suppliers and customers. The work environment is often varied and can include administrative work as well as practical tasks in stables and on the farm, with workdays driven by animal needs and seasonal changes.
Salary development over time
Over the past three years, salary development for landowners in poultry farming has shown moderate growth. In 2022, the average salary was 27,200 SEK, rising to 29 400 in 2023, and remaining at the same level in 2024. This represents a total increase of approximately 4.4% from 2022 to 2024, with a slowdown in growth during the last year. The relatively stable salary level can be explained by steady demand for the role and a labor market where wages are influenced by market prices for poultry products and changes within the agricultural sector. Despite some recruitment difficulties and a certain proportion of part-time workers, salary development has been relatively stable, reflecting an industry balanced between supply and demand.
Landowner in agriculture specializing in poultry farming salary – full overview
- Average salary: 29 400 SEK/month
- Lowest salary: 27,000 SEK/month (female, private sector employee, 3-year high school)
- Highest salary: 32,500 SEK/month (female, public sector, up to 2-year high school)
- Hourly wage (average): 171 SEK
- Women earn: 29 300 SEK/month (100% of men's salary)
- Men earn: 29,700 SEK/month
- Regional differences: May occur depending on demand and proximity to larger markets

Education and qualifications
To work as a landowner in agriculture focusing on poultry breeding, a combination of formal education in agriculture and practical experience in animal husbandry is usually required. Many have a high school education in natural resource use, but further training and specialized courses in poultry breeding are also common. Practical experience and knowledge of business operations are often crucial for success in the profession.
- High school education: Natural resource use program, specialization in agriculture (3 years)
- Vocational college education: Courses in animal husbandry or agriculture (1–2 years)
- Certifications: Courses in animal welfare, food hygiene, and environment
- Internships: Long-term internships at farms focusing on poultry are common
- Business courses: Economics and leadership for farmers

Competition and challenges
The profession of landowner in poultry farming is characterized by competition from both larger agricultural companies and smaller, specialized operators. One of the biggest challenges is meeting requirements for animal welfare and food safety, while ensuring production remains cost-effective. Market prices for poultry products can vary greatly, affecting profitability. Additionally, recruitment difficulties exist due to many working part-time, and technological development requires continuous skills development. Despite this, job opportunities are considered large, but high demands are placed on both practical and theoretical competence.

Career paths and future prospects
After three to five years in the profession, a landowner in agriculture focusing on poultry breeding can advance to greater responsibilities such as operations manager for multiple farms or advisor in animal husbandry. There are also opportunities to specialize in areas like animal health, sustainability, or technological solutions for agriculture. According to the Swedish Public Employment Service forecasts, job opportunities are large, and demand is expected to remain unchanged over five years. The industry is characterized by recruitment difficulties, especially due to many part-time workers, which can be advantageous for those with broad skills and flexibility. Digitalization and sustainability issues are expected to influence the development of the profession in the future.

About the data
All information displayed on this page is based on data from the Swedish Central Bureau of Statistics (SCB), the Swedish Tax Agency and the Swedish employment agency. Learn more about our data and data sources here.
All figures are gross salaries, meaning salaries before tax. The average salary, or mean salary, is calculated by adding up the total salary for all individuals within the profession and dividing it by the number of individuals. For specific job categories, we have also considered various criteria such as experience and education.
Profession Landowners, farming poultry breeders has the SSYK code 6121, which we use to match against the SCB database to obtain the latest salary statistics.
